anthozoan: Meaning and Definition of
an•tho•zo•an
Pronunciation: (an"thu-zō'un), [key] — n.
- any marine coelenterate of the class Anthozoa, comprising colonial and solitary polyps and including corals, sea anemones, sea pens, etc.
—adj. - belonging or pertaining to the anthozoans.
